Understanding Towing Rights: What You Need to Know

Towing rights are a complex area governed by local regulations and property laws. Typically, a vehicle may be towed for reasons such as illegal parking in private lots or failure to adhere to posted parking limits. For example, if a car is parked in a restricted parking zone without a permit, the vehicle owner can expect enforcement action, which may include towing. In many municipalities, the towing company must follow specific protocols, including notifying the vehicle owner and local authorities within a set timeframe.

If your vehicle has been towed, the first step is to locate the towing company, which is often listed on signage in the area where the vehicle was parked. Once identified, contact them to confirm the towing details. Be prepared to present identification and vehicle ownership documentation, which is generally required to retrieve your car. Costs associated with towing can vary widely; in some areas, towing fees range from $100 to $300, and additional storage fees may accrue daily.

Legal implications can also arise, especially if the towing appears unjustified. If you believe your vehicle was improperly towed, you may contest the charge through local administrative hearings. Familiarizing yourself with the official parking rules in your jurisdiction is crucial to understanding your rights and responsibilities. Common mistakes include failing to read signage properly or not knowing how to navigate the appeals process effectively, which can cost both time and money.

Practical Tips for Navigating Towing Rights

Understanding towing regulations is essential for every driver to protect their rights. First, always check for signage in parking areas. Clear and conspicuous signage detailing towing policies is required in many jurisdictions. If your vehicle is towed, take photos of the signs as evidence for potential disputes.

Second, familiarize yourself with local laws regarding towing. Many cities have specific regulations that dictate when a vehicle can be legally removed. For instance, according to the California Vehicle Code, vehicles cannot be towed from private property without proper notice. Knowing these details can significantly help your case in disputing a tow.
